Skip to main content

¿Cómo crear una carpeta de búsqueda para todos los correos electrónicos no respondidos en Outlook?

Author: Xiaoyang Last Modified: 2025-08-06

Si deseas revisar los correos electrónicos no respondidos en tu Outlook, buscarlos uno por uno llevará mucho tiempo. En este artículo, hablaré sobre cómo crear una carpeta de búsqueda para todos los mensajes no respondidos.

Crear una carpeta de búsqueda para todos los correos electrónicos no respondidos en Outlook con código VBA


Crear una carpeta de búsqueda para todos los correos electrónicos no respondidos en Outlook con código VBA

El siguiente código VBA puede ayudarte a crear una carpeta de búsqueda donde se colocarán todos los correos electrónicos no respondidos; por favor, sigue estos pasos:

1. Mantén presionadas las teclas ALT + F11 para abrir la ventana de Microsoft Visual Basic para Aplicaciones.

2. Haz clic en Insertar > Módulo, y pega la siguiente macro en la Ventana del Módulo.

Código VBA: Crear una carpeta de búsqueda para correos electrónicos no respondidos:

Sub CreateSearchFolder_AllNotRepliedEmails()
    Dim xSearch As Outlook.Search
    Dim xScope As String, xFilter As String
    Dim xRepliedProperty As String
    Dim xFolder As Folder, xSubFolder As Folder
    On Error Resume Next
    xScope = ""
    For Each xFolder In Outlook.Application.Session.Folders
        Set xSubFolder = xFolder.Folders("Inbox")
        xScope = "'" + xSubFolder.FolderPath + "'"
        xRepliedProperty = "http://schemas.microsoft.com/mapi/proptag/0x10810003"
        xFilter = Chr(34) & xRepliedProperty & Chr(34) & " <> 102" & "AND" & Chr(34) & xRepliedProperty & Chr(34) & " <> 103"
        Set xSearch = Outlook.Application.AdvancedSearch(Scope:=xScope, Filter:=xFilter, SearchSubFolders:=True, Tag:="SearchFolder")
        xSearch.Save("Not Replied Emails").ShowItemCount = olShowTotalItemCount
        Set xSearch = Nothing
        Set xSubFolder = Nothing
    Next
    MsgBox "Search folder is created successfully!", vbInformation + vbOKOnly, "Kutools for Outlook"
End Sub

3. Luego, presiona la tecla F5 para ejecutar este código, y aparecerá un cuadro de diálogo como se muestra en la siguiente captura de pantalla:

doc search folder for unreplied 1

4. Haz clic en el botón Aceptar, ahora verás una carpeta Correos No Respondidos bajo las Carpetas de Búsqueda para cada cuenta en tu Outlook, y todos los correos electrónicos no respondidos se mostrarán aquí, mira la siguiente captura de pantalla:

doc search folder for unreplied 2

Las mejores herramientas de productividad para Office

Últimas noticias: ¡Kutools para Outlook lanza una versión gratuita!

¡Descubre el nuevo Kutools para Outlook con más de100 funciones increíbles! ¡Haz clic para descargarlo ahora!

🤖 Kutools AI : Utiliza tecnología avanzada de IA para gestionar correos electrónicos sin esfuerzo, como responder, resumir, optimizar, ampliar, traducir y redactar mensajes.

📧 Automatización de Email: Respuesta automática (disponible para POP e IMAP) / Programar envío de correos electrónicos / CC/BCC automático por regla al enviar correo / Reenvío automático (Regla avanzada) / Agregar saludo automáticamente / Dividir automáticamente correos con varios destinatarios en mensajes individuales ...

📨 Gestión de Email: Recuperar correos electrónicos / Bloquear correos sospechosos por asunto y otros criterios / Eliminar correos electrónicos duplicados / Búsqueda Avanzada / Organizar carpetas ...

📁 Adjuntos Pro: Guardar en lote / Desanexar en lote / Comprimir en lote / Guardar automáticamente / Desconectar automáticamente / Auto Comprimir ...

🌟 Magia de la Interfaz: 😊Más emojis atractivos y geniales / Recibe avisos cuando lleguen emails importantes / Minimiza Outlook en vez de cerrarlo ...

👍 Funciones de un solo clic: Responder a Todos con Adjuntos / Correos electrónicos Anti-Phishing / 🕘Mostrar la zona horaria del remitente ...

👩🏼‍🤝‍👩🏻 Contactos y Calendario: Agregar en lote contactos de correos seleccionados / Dividir un grupo de contactos en grupos individuales / Eliminar recordatorio de cumpleaños ...

Utiliza Kutools en tu idioma preferido; ¡compatible con Inglés, Español, Alemán, Francés, Chino y más de40 idiomas adicionales!

Desbloquea Kutools para Outlook al instante con un solo clic. ¡No esperes más, descárgalo ahora y aumenta tu productividad!

kutools for outlook features1 kutools for outlook features2